#6059c4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6059c4 is composed of 37.6% red, 34.9%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51% cyan, 54.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 243.9 degrees, a saturation of 47.6% and a lightness of 55.9%. #6059c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#c0b2ff with #000089.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#6059c4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030308 is the darkest color, while #f8f8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#6059c4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8d90 is the less saturated color, while #3325f8 is the most saturated one.
